How much do discipleship pastor j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average yearly pay for discipleship pastor in Georgia is $41,071.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$35,500.00 and $48,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a discipleship pastor?

A Discipleship Pastor oversees spiritual growth and discipleship efforts within a church, helping members grow in their faith and develop as followers of Christ. They typically lead small groups, Bible studies, and mentorship programs while equipping leaders to disciple others. Their role includes teaching, pastoral care, and creating strategies to foster deeper community engagement. Ultimately, they help guide the church in spiritual formation and Christian maturity.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a discipleship pastor?

A Discipleship Pastor typically leads small group ministries, develops and implements discipleship curricula, and provides spiritual mentoring to congregation members. They regularly collaborate with other church staff to align ministry efforts, train volunteer leaders, and organize outreach or community-building events. Pastoral counseling, prayer support, and facilitating Bible studies are also integral parts of the role. This position offers variety in daily tasks, meaningful interactions with people, and the opportunity to nurture personal and communal spiritual growth.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the discipleship pastor position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Discipleship Pastor, you need a deep understanding of biblical teachings, experience in spiritual leadership, and often a degree in theology or ministry. Familiarity with church management software, curriculum development tools, and occasional certification in pastoral counseling are beneficial. Exceptional interpersonal skills, empathy, and the ability to inspire and mentor others distinguish successful candidates in this role. These competencies are vital for fostering spiritual growth within the congregation and leading effective discipleship programs.

Senior Pastor

Senior Pastor
  First Baptist Church of Haynesville, Georgia (FBCH), has begun the prayerful search for our next Senior Pastor.  FBCH is located on U.S. Highway 341 South between Perry and Hawkinsville in Houston (pronounced “House-ton”) County.  We are an historic, rural congregation of over 201 years situated to reach a new generation in a region experiencing very rapid growth.  By the power of the Holy Spirit and for the Glory of God, we seek a pastor who will join us in our vision to be a unified and growing church, strengthening every generation to walk in truth and love as we reach our community for Christ.  
  Our church seeks a pastor who meets the Scriptural qualifications of 1 Timothy 3:1-7 and Titus 1:6-9 and has been subsequently ordained in a Southern Baptist Church.  
  We desire an experienced leader with strong preaching skills and a pastor’s heart. 
  We seek a pastor who is comfortable with traditional worship but patient to lead us and      the church staff to grow in worship and discipleship to reach a new generation. 
  In seeking God’s man, we desire a pastor who has been prepared through theological and ministry training, preferably with a minimum of a bachelor’s degree from an accredited school.
  FBCH is a Southern Baptist Church affiliated with the GA Baptist Mission Board and the Rehobeth Baptist Association and would see a pastor who believes in the inerrancy of Scripture and is fully supportive of the Baptist Faith and Message, 2000, as expressing the beliefs and practices of our faith.
  We would also seek a pastor who is supportive of North American and International missions and through the Gospel, all people of every race and nation may come to salvation through Jesus Christ, the Son of God.  A pastor who does not wish that any should perish but that all should come unto repentance (2 Peter 3:9) and that everyone who calls upon the name of the Lord shall be saved (Romans 10:13).
